Amid the threat of rains in Dang, the district administration has taken a strict decision: Entry to all water bodies, including rivers, waterfalls, lakes, etc., has been banned till July 22.

The district administration has taken an important decision to prevent heavy rains and drowning incidents in tourist places in Dang district. The Additional District Magistrate has issued a notification under Section 163 of the Indian Civil Suraksha Code-2023 (BNSS) and imposed a complete ban on entry and all activities in all rivers, waterfalls, lakes, check dams and other water bodies in the district. The ban will remain in force till July 22, 2026. According to the notification, during the monsoon, there is a sudden surge in the flow of water in rivers and waterfalls, posing a serious threat to the lives of tourists and locals. Incidents of drowning have been reported in various parts of the state as well as in Dang district recently. In view of this situation, this restrictive measure has been taken with a view to avoid any loss of life. During this ban, no person will be allowed to enter rivers, waterfalls, lakes, check dams or other water bodies, bathing, swimming, taking selfies, photography or any other activity including boating. The district administration has appealed to the tourists and local citizens to strictly adhere to the notification and give priority to the safety of themselves and their families. The administration has made it clear that legal action will be taken against the person violating the notification under Section 223 of the Indian Justice Code-2023 (BNS). District police, revenue department, forest department and other concerned departments have been instructed for effective implementation of the notification. Regular patrolling and surveillance will be done at the tourist destinations. The district administration has appealed to the tourists visiting all the tourist places in the district including Saputara, especially during the monsoon season, to stay away from dangerous places, follow the instructions of the authorities and give top priority to safety. Officials believe that precious human lives can be saved by preventing potential accidents only with the cooperation of citizens.
